The WIFI signal your phone can see  is from the controller.

The controller is basically a router.

The controller communicates with the phone and the bird.

The control of the Phantom is 5.8 and the video is 2.4, you still have radio control but no video.
Also, I know there has been some issues if you have At&t. Their phones had some kind of smart WiFi app that would keep trying to reconnect to your home WiFI. Don't know if you have At&t or not.
Have you also tried away from your house, like a park with no WiFI around.
If you have tried deleting the app and reinstalled, resetting the WiFi, trying different devices, and nothing works I'd say you need to send it in for repair.
